BeMetals Corp (BMET) has a Defensive Interval Ratio of 235 days as of September 2025. Defensive assets of CA$65.99K (cash CA$-, short-term investments CA$46.00K, receivables CA$19.99K) cover 235 days of daily cash needs of CA$281.29/day.
